Art Analysis
Finding Stillness Within the Grungy Shroud of a Snowstorm
In Snowfall, Carruth presents a nighttime tableau where the environment feels both protective and precarious. A couple traverses a bridge, their forms becoming secondary to the swirling, abstracted elements of the storm that threaten to dissolve the path into a crumbling cliff. The composition uses a grungy, collage-like texture to ground the surreal landscape, layering pine trees and crystalline flakes against a vibrant pink and purple palette.
The work explores the sensory shift that occurs when nature mutes the world. As the snow on the ground reflects the night light and absorbs every sound, the act of walking becomes an exercise in serene isolation. Carruth uses watercolor techniques to blend the trekkers into their surroundings, illustrating that rare moment when being lost in a winter forest feels less like a danger and more like a quiet, immersive sanctuary.
